As we progress through 2026, the automated sorting market has evolved from simple mechanical diverters to sophisticated AI-driven systems capable of processing over 40,000 parcels per hour with 99.99% accuracy. The integration of machine learning algorithms, computer vision sensors, and IoT connectivity has transformed these machines from mere conveyors into intelligent decision-making nodes within the broader supply chain ecosystem.
Modern sorting systems leverage advanced deep learning models trained on millions of parcel images to identify package dimensions, barcodes, surface textures, and even damage indicators in real-time. These vision systems can process up to 120 frames per second, enabling split-second routing decisions that maximize throughput while minimizing errors.
Unlike traditional rule-based systems, next-generation sorters employ reinforcement learning to continuously optimize their routing strategies based on historical performance data. These algorithms can predict peak periods, adjust to seasonal variations, and even learn from operator interventions to improve decision-making accuracy over time.
Every component of modern sorting infrastructure is now connected through industrial IoT protocols, creating a digital twin that mirrors physical operations in real-time. This enables predictive maintenance, remote diagnostics, and simulation-based optimization without disrupting live operations.
| IoT Feature | Capability | Business Impact |
|---|---|---|
| Predictive Maintenance | Vibration & temperature monitoring | 40% reduction in unplanned downtime |
| Energy Optimization | Real-time load balancing | 25% decrease in energy consumption |
| Throughput Analytics | Bottleneck identification | 18% improvement in overall capacity |
| Quality Assurance | Automated defect tracking | 99.95% outbound quality rate |

The explosive growth of online retail has created unprecedented demand for flexible sorting solutions capable of handling SKU proliferation and same-day delivery expectations. Leading e-commerce operators have deployed smart sorters that can dynamically reroute packages based on real-time carrier selection algorithms, optimizing shipping costs while meeting service level agreements.
Major courier companies have integrated AI-powered sorters into their hub-and-spoke networks, reducing transit times by 23% on average. These systems automatically prioritize time-sensitive shipments, route packages around congestion points, and balance loads across available resources to meet tight delivery windows.
Next-generation baggage sorting systems combine security screening with efficient routing, achieving 100% TSA/ICAO compliance while maintaining throughput levels that support airport growth projections. Computer vision integration enables automatic detection of prohibited items with 99.97% accuracy.

Sorters will increasingly communicate directly with autonomous mobile robots (AMRs) and automated guided vehicles (AGVs), creating fully coordinated material flow systems that require minimal human oversight. Early adopters report 35% improvements in end-to-end fulfillment cycle times.
On-device AI processing capabilities will enable real-time optimization decisions without cloud latency, supporting sub-millisecond response times for high-speed applications exceeding 50,000 parcels/hour.
Energy recovery systems, biodegradable components, and carbon-neutral manufacturing processes will become standard requirements. Leading manufacturers already offer regenerative braking that recovers up to 30% of kinetic energy during deceleration cycles.
